How much do valley health systems jobs pay per hour?

As of Jul 13, 2026, the average hourly pay for valley health systems in the United States is $27.49,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$21.39 and $31.97 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

Summary
Completes assessments/evaluations, develops and implements treatment goals, facilitates referrals/resources both internally within the Lehigh Valley Health Network continuum and throughout the community, and provides therapeutic interventions to address patient's mental health needs. Functions as a member of a multi-disciplinary care team privileged by the Department of Psychiatry.
Job Duties

  • Assesses and identifies a patient's behavioral health needs, barriers to care, and therapeutic interventions/techniques to assist the patient to their optimal level of functioning.
  • Demonstrates expertise in various therapeutic modalities, the DSM 5 Classification system, multi-cultural issues, and employing counseling and education skills to empower their patients.
  • Completes medical record documentation in a timely manner in accordance with program, departmental, regulatory, third party payor, and network compliance standards.
  • Works collaboratively with both internal/external customers and teams. Uses knowledge of available resources to ensure patient care needs are met and transitions of care coordinated.


Minimum Qualifications

  • Master's Degree in counseling, social work, or other clinical discipline, such as psychology.
  • 2 years experience in counseling or social work in a mental health related field.
  • Ability to use good judgement to respond to emergencies.
  • Ability to establish program goals and objectives that support the strategic plan.
  • Comprehensive understanding of behavioral health services and appropriate levels of care.
  • Familiarity with differential diagnosis of common mental health and/or substance use disorders.
  • Knowledge of public health problems, principles, and practices.
  • LCSW - Licensed Clinical Social Worker - State of Pennsylvania Upon Hire or
  • LPC - Licensed Professional Counselor - State of Pennsylvania Upon Hire


Physical Demands
Lift and carry 7 lbs., continuous sitting >67%, frequent keyboard use/repetitive motion, frequent fine motor activity/wrist position deviation.
